|
KiCad PCB EDA Suite
|
This is the complete list of members for KIGFX::SHADER, including all inherited members.
| active | KIGFX::SHADER | private |
| AddParameter(const std::string &aParameterName) | KIGFX::SHADER | |
| ConfigureGeometryShader(GLuint maxVertices, GLuint geometryInputType, GLuint geometryOutputType) | KIGFX::SHADER | |
| Deactivate() | KIGFX::SHADER | inline |
| geomInputType | KIGFX::SHADER | private |
| geomOutputType | KIGFX::SHADER | private |
| GetAttribute(const std::string &aAttributeName) const | KIGFX::SHADER | |
| IsActive() const | KIGFX::SHADER | inline |
| IsLinked() const | KIGFX::SHADER | inline |
| isProgramCreated | KIGFX::SHADER | private |
| isShaderLinked | KIGFX::SHADER | private |
| Link() | KIGFX::SHADER | |
| LoadShaderFromFile(SHADER_TYPE aShaderType, const std::string &aShaderSourceName) | KIGFX::SHADER | |
| loadShaderFromStringArray(SHADER_TYPE aShaderType, const char **aArray, size_t aSize) | KIGFX::SHADER | private |
| LoadShaderFromStrings(SHADER_TYPE aShaderType, Args &&... aArgs) | KIGFX::SHADER | inline |
| maximumVertices | KIGFX::SHADER | private |
| parameterLocation | KIGFX::SHADER | private |
| programInfo(GLuint aProgram) | KIGFX::SHADER | private |
| programNumber | KIGFX::SHADER | private |
| ReadSource(const std::string &aShaderSourceName) | KIGFX::SHADER | static |
| SetParameter(int aParameterNumber, float aValue) const | KIGFX::SHADER | |
| SetParameter(int aParameterNumber, int aValue) const | KIGFX::SHADER | |
| SetParameter(int aParameterNumber, const VECTOR2D &aValue) const | KIGFX::SHADER | |
| SetParameter(int aParameterNumber, float f0, float f1, float f2, float f3) const | KIGFX::SHADER | |
| SHADER() | KIGFX::SHADER | |
| shaderInfo(GLuint aShader) | KIGFX::SHADER | private |
| shaderNumbers | KIGFX::SHADER | private |
| Use() | KIGFX::SHADER | inline |
| ~SHADER() | KIGFX::SHADER | virtual |